The best way to spend less on your Preston Torquay train ticket must be to have a railcard. While regional railcards exist in some areas, National railcards enable you to make savings on most rail fares across the United Kingdom. Everyone is eligible to at least one of the railcard, even non-UK citizens. National railcards available: 16-25 railcard, Senior discount card, Two together railcard, Family and Friends discount card and Disabled persons railcard.
How much can I save with a railcard?
In order to understand the benefits of a railcard, you can assess the number of journeys you need to break even. You will see that usually only a few trips are needed.
For your assessment, you have to include the cost of your railcard, i.e £30, your savings on each journey (i.e.: 34%) as well as the cost of your ticket. The average price of a Preston Torquay ticket is £50.00 (1).
Divide the cost of your railcard by the discount: £30/34%= £88. Then divide £88 by £50.00: £88/£50.00 = 1.76. You will need to make about 2 trips from Torquay to Preston (one way trip) with your railcard to break even.
How much do I need to pay for a railcard?
Railcards enable you to get a third off most adult fares for a year. The Disabled persons railcard costs £20 and the 5 other railcards £30.
